Hodgkinson was NSW MLA for Burrinjuck 1999-2015, for Cootamundra 2015-17. 2. Schultz was the son of Alby Schultz, MHR for Hume 1998-2013. He was the Liberal candidate before being replaced by Mundine. -------------------------------------------------------------------- 2nd count: Kolukupally's 1,853 votes distributed -------------------------------------------------------------------- McCallum 96 05.2 10,836 10.1 Schultz 266 14.4 7,851 07.3 Leslight 177 09.6 3,815 03.5 Phillips 186 10.0 39,158 36.4 Hodgkinson 367 19.8 13,829 12.8 Mundine + 761 41.1 32,188 29.9 -------------------------------------------------------------------- Total 1,853 107,677 -------------------------------------------------------------------- 3rd count: Leslight's 3,815 votes distributed -------------------------------------------------------------------- McCallum 356 09.3 11,192 10.4 Schultz 1,293 33.9 9,144 08.5 Phillips 556 14.6 39,714 36.9 Hodgkinson 675 17.7 14,504 13.5 Mundine + 935 24.5 33,123 30.8 -------------------------------------------------------------------- Total 3,815 107,677 -------------------------------------------------------------------- 4th count: Schultz's 9,144 votes distributed -------------------------------------------------------------------- McCallum 1,720 18.8 12,912 12.0 Phillips 2,277 24.9 41,991 39.0 Hodgkinson 3,352 36.7 17,856 16.6 Mundine + 1,795 19.6 34,918 32.4 -------------------------------------------------------------------- Total 9,144 107,677 -------------------------------------------------------------------- 5th count: McCallum's 12,912 votes distributed -------------------------------------------------------------------- Phillips 9,809 76.0 51,800 48.1 Hodgkinson 1,922 14.9 19,778 18.4 Mundine + 1,181 09.2 36,099 33.5 -------------------------------------------------------------------- Total 12,912 107,677 -------------------------------------------------------------------- 6th count: Hodgkinson's 19,778 votes distributed -------------------------------------------------------------------- PHILLIPS 4,852 24.5 56,652 52.6 Mundine + 14,926 75.5 51,025 47.4 -------------------------------------------------------------------- Total 19,778 107,677 02.6 03.3 to ALP -------------------------------------------------------------------- Fiona Evon Phillips (born 1970): Elected 2019 Born: 18 February 1970, Nowra NSW Career: Educated University of Newcastle.
